Columbia Top Prospect: On the mound, the 6-foot-1, 190-pound Willenbrink pounded the strike zone with his 75-77 mph fastball, while also consistently locating a 65-67 mph curve and 71 mph change up with good arm speed and fade. In the field, he showcased an accurate arm (73 mph) with decent carry. At the plate, Willenbrink demonstrated good bat speed when he kept his weight back, and his level extension generated gap-to-gap contact.
St. Louis Top Prospect: The 6-foot-1, 185-pound Willenbrink has a well built athletic frame, and showed ability as a two way player. On the mound, his best pitch is a late moving 11-to-5 breaking ball (76-71 mph), which has the potential to be a legitimate out pitch. He also showed a 72-74 mph change up with late movement. Willenbrink’s fastball sat 76-78. At the plate, Willenbrink has power potential, and with some fine tuning could be a consistent power hitter. He showed some barrel whip, driving the ball gap-to-gap.
